Existing customers adopt Camunda for many use cases
We learned from our customers that they want to use Camunda for a wide variety of use cases. Many of the use cases are core end-to-end business processes, like customer onboarding, order fulfillment, claim settlement, payment processing, trading, or the like.
But customers also need to automate simpler processes. Those processes are less complex, less critical, and typically less valuable, but still those processes are there and automating them has a return on investment or is simply necessary to fulfill customer expectations. Good examples are around master data changes (e.g. address or bank account data), bank transfer limits, annual mileage reports for insurances, delay compensation, and so on.

Democratization and acceleration by Connectors
There are two main motivations to use Connectors.
Software developers might simply become more productive by using them, and this is what we call acceleration. For example, it might simply be quicker to use a Twilio Connector instead of figuring out the REST API for sending an SMS and how it is best called from Java. As mentioned, if this is not true for you, e.g. because you have an internal library you simply use to hide the complexity of using Twilio, this is great, then you just keep using that. Also, when you want to write more JUnit tests, it might be simpler to write integration code in Java yourself. This is fine! You are not forced to use Connectors, it is an offer, and if it makes your life easier, use them.
The other more important advantage is that it allows a more diverse set of people to take part in solution creation, which is referred to as democratization. So for example, a tech-savvy business person could probably stitch together a simpler process using Connectors, even if they cannot write any programming code. Remember, we are talking about the long tail of simpler processes (yellow) here.

Avoiding the danger zone when doing vendor rationalization and tool harmonization
Many organizations currently try to reduce the number of vendors and tools they are using. This is understandable on many levels, but it is very risky if the different non-functional requirements of green, yellow, and red processes are ignored.
For example, procurement departments might not want to have multiple process automation tools. But for them, the difference between Camunda and a low-code vendor is not very tangible as they both automate processes.
For red use cases, customers can still easily argue why they cannot use a low-code tool because those tools simply don’t fit into professional software development approaches. But for yellow use cases, this gets much more complicated to argue. This can lead to a situation where low-code tools, made for green use cases, are applied for yellow ones. This might work for very simple yellow processes, but can easily become risky if processes are getting too complex, or simply if requirements around stability, resilience, easing maintenance, scalability or information security rise over time. This is why I consider this a big danger zone for companies to be in.
